In the meantime, do like Akane said... The longer you store fertile eggs, the lower your hatch rate will probably be. And although people HAVE hatched eggs that have been stored in the fridge, it is NOT recommended to refrigerate them, if you want them to hatch. Refrigerated eggs also have a lower hatch rate.

The bubble wrap is just to keep them from breaking, and to keep them insulated, while they are being shipped, you can take it off.
